/*================================================================================
	Item Name: Modern Admin - Clean Bootstrap 4 Dashboard HTML Template
	Version: 1.0
	Author: PIXINVENT
	Author URL: http://www.themeforest.net/user/pixinvent
================================================================================

NOTE:
------
PLACE HERE YOUR OWN SCSS CODES AND IF NEEDED, OVERRIDE THE STYLES FROM THE OTHER STYLESHEETS.
WE WILL RELEASE FUTURE UPDATES SO IN ORDER TO NOT OVERWRITE YOUR STYLES IT'S BETTER LIKE THIS.  */

A.bluelink {
	color:#407AB7;	
}

.pageheader {
	font-family:Montserrat;
	font-weight:lighter;
	color:#5D2A7B;
}


/* LABEL SCANNER */
#dimScreen {
    width: 100%;
    height: 100%;
    background:rgba(255,255,255,0.5); 
    position: fixed;
    top: 0;
    left: 0;
    z-index: 100; /* Just to keep it at the very top */
	text-align:center;
}

.bggreen {
	background-color:#B0D136;	
	color:#5D2A7B;
}

/* SUPER ADMIN */
.superAdminTH {
	text-align:center;
	background-color:#5D2A7B;
	color:#ffffff;
}

/* PRACTITIONER */
.practitionerTH {
	text-align:center;
	background-color:#B0D136;
	color:#ffffff;	
}

/* Recipe Ref number 
.recipeRef {
	font-size: 10px;	
}*/

/* FORM CHECKING START */
	.error_formchecking {
		font-size:11px; color: #F8827A;	font-weight:bold;
	}
/* FORM CHECKING END */


.ajinomotocambrookeTH {
	background: #ffffff;
	border-left: 8px solid #5C6770;
	/*border: 2px solid #ED1C24;
	border-top: 2px solid #ED1C24;
	border-bottom: 2px solid #ED1C24;*/
}

.nutriciaTH {
	background: #ffffff;
	border-left: 8px solid #502B76;
	/*border: 2px solid #502B76;
	border-top: 2px solid #502B76;
	border-bottom: 2px solid #502B76;*/
}

.vitafloTH {
	background: #ffffff;
	border-left: 8px solid #231E46;
	/*border: 2px solid #502B76;
	border-top: 2px solid #502B76;
	border-bottom: 2px solid #502B76;*/
}

.matthewsfriendscanadaTH {
	background: #ffffff;
	border-left: 8px solid #EF2121;
	/*border: 2px solid #502B76;
	border-top: 2px solid #502B76;
	border-bottom: 2px solid #502B76;*/
}

#btnrecipesave{
	animation: btn-pulse 2.1s infinite ease-in;
	box-shadow: 1px 1px #FFFFFF;
}
#btnmealsave{
	animation: btn-pulse 2.1s infinite ease-in;
	box-shadow: 1px 1px #FFFFFF;
}
#btnplan{
	animation: btn-pulse 2.1s infinite ease-in;
	box-shadow: 1px 1px #FFFFFF;
}
@keyframes btn-pulse {
  0% {
    transform: scale(1.00);
	box-shadow: 1px 1px #FFFFFF; 
  }
  50% {
    transform: scale(1.1); 
	box-shadow: 1px 1px #B0D136;
  }

  100% {
    transform: scale(1.00); 
	box-shadow: 1px 1px #FFFFFF;
  }
}

.saverecipe_label {
	font-size: small; 
	color: #6B6F82;	
	font-weight: normal;
}

/* Container holding the image and the text */
.containerCategory {
  position: relative;
  text-align: center;
  float:left;
}
/* Centered text */
.centeredCategory {
  position: absolute;
  /*top: 50%;*/
  transform: translate(-50%,0%);
  bottom: 8px;
  left: 50%;
  
  color: white;
  font-size:20px;
}

/* macroprescription-plan.php macroprescription_classic.js */

.savePrescriptionBtn {
	width:25px;
	height:25px;
	padding:0px 0px;
	color:#FFFFFF;
	border: none; /*#00BCD4; */
	background-color:#00BCD4; 
	border-radius: 2px; 	
	transition-duration: 0.4s;
}

.savePrescriptionBtn:hover {
	color:#FFFFFF;
	/*border:#006977;*/
	border: none;
	background-color:#006977;
}

.savePrescriptionBtn:visited  {
	color:#FFFFFF;
	background-color:#006977;
	border: none;
}